Doctor's Best 5-HTP 100mg is derived from the seeds of Griffonia simplicifolia — a West African plant that is the primary commercial source of 5-hydroxytryptophan (5-HTP). 5-HTP is the direct precursor to serotonin, the neurotransmitter that plays a key role in regulating mood, sleep, appetite, and stress responses. Unlike tryptophan, 5-HTP crosses the blood-brain barrier efficiently and is converted into serotonin without requiring a co-factor, making it a highly targeted approach to serotonin support.*

5-HTP (5-hydroxytryptophan) is a naturally occurring amino acid that the body uses as a direct precursor to serotonin — the "feel good" neurotransmitter. Unlike tryptophan, which must compete with other amino acids to cross the blood-brain barrier, 5-HTP crosses freely and is converted to serotonin with high efficiency. Supporting serotonin levels through 5-HTP may help maintain a positive mood, emotional balance, and a healthy stress response.*
